A Certificate Programme in Conflict Resolution is increasingly significant for music copyists in the UK’s competitive market. The music industry, encompassing composition, arrangement, and transcription, often involves collaborative projects fraught with potential disputes over intellectual property, creative differences, or payment disagreements. According to the Musicians' Union, approximately 30% of UK musicians report experiencing contract disputes annually. This highlights a growing need for conflict resolution skills within the profession.

Successful music copyists are not only proficient in notation software and music theory but are also adept at navigating interpersonal challenges. A conflict resolution certificate equips copyists with practical skills in negotiation, mediation, and communication, fostering smoother working relationships and avoiding costly legal battles. This is particularly relevant in the freelance sector, where a majority (estimated at 70% based on industry reports) of music copyists operate, often engaging with multiple clients simultaneously.
